study guides for every class

that actually explain what's on your next test

Logarithmic transformation

from class:

Cognitive Computing in Business

Definition

Logarithmic transformation is a mathematical technique used to convert data that spans several orders of magnitude into a more manageable scale by applying a logarithm function. This transformation helps stabilize variance, normalize data distribution, and reveal underlying patterns that may be obscured in raw data, making it an essential tool for feature engineering and selection in machine learning and statistical modeling.

congrats on reading the definition of logarithmic transformation.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Logarithmic transformation is particularly useful when dealing with skewed data or data that has exponential growth patterns, as it can help create a more symmetric distribution.
  2. This transformation can reduce the influence of outliers by compressing large values and expanding smaller values, leading to improved model accuracy.
  3. Common logarithmic bases include natural logarithm (base e) and common logarithm (base 10), each serving different purposes depending on the context of analysis.
  4. When applying logarithmic transformation, it's important to handle zero or negative values properly, as the logarithm of zero and negative numbers is undefined; often a constant is added to shift the data.
  5. Logarithmic transformation is frequently used in regression models to linearize relationships between variables, making it easier to identify trends and correlations.

Review Questions

  • How does logarithmic transformation help in stabilizing variance in a dataset?
    • Logarithmic transformation helps stabilize variance by compressing the range of data values. When dealing with datasets where some values are significantly larger than others, the variance can be disproportionately influenced by these outliers. By applying a logarithmic scale, large values are pulled closer to smaller ones, reducing the overall spread of the data and leading to more consistent variance across the dataset.
  • Discuss how logarithmic transformation can impact feature selection in machine learning models.
    • Logarithmic transformation can significantly influence feature selection by revealing relationships that may not be apparent in raw data. For instance, when features exhibit non-linear relationships with the target variable, applying a logarithmic transformation can linearize these relationships, making them more suitable for linear modeling techniques. As a result, features that show improved correlation with the target post-transformation may be prioritized during the feature selection process, enhancing model performance.
  • Evaluate the implications of improperly applying logarithmic transformation on model outcomes and interpretability.
    • Improper application of logarithmic transformation can lead to distorted model outcomes and reduced interpretability. If the transformation is applied without addressing issues like zero or negative values, it may generate undefined results or misleading interpretations. Furthermore, if the transformation is not aligned with the nature of the data—such as applying it to normally distributed data—it could obscure important patterns rather than reveal them. Thus, careful consideration and pre-processing steps are essential to ensure that the benefits of logarithmic transformation are fully realized while maintaining clear interpretability.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.